The cod plays the main<br />

role as a genuine companion fish<br />

in the salmon fishery. It is being<br />

caught mainly with driftlines, very<br />

rarely in nets (Table 20). The<br />

fishermen are of the opinion that<br />

the occurrences of salmon and cod<br />

exclude each other and they cite<br />

as proof that during a large catch<br />

of cod only very few salmon are<br />

being caught. Concerning this it<br />

must be .said that a hook that has already been taken by a cod, can no<br />

longer catch a salmon. Since there exists a food competition between the<br />

two species of fish, it is possible that an effect of gear saturation may<br />

be reached. According to the number x of the cod already hooked, we have<br />

then a catch of salmon, not per 1000 hooks, but per 1000 x hooks. The<br />

catches of salmon can be influenced in this way by the presence of cod.<br />

Vice versa, the yield of cod can also be influenced by the salmon. There .<br />

will thus become eàablished an equilibrium between the two species. A<br />

shift will always occur when the population density of one species changes<br />

in relation to that of the other.<br />

Effects of this kind can find expression in the ratio between<br />

the salmon catches with lines and in nets (Table 9) because cod are hardly<br />

cc..td.es<br />

ever caught in driftnets. The falsification of the ceptueeQ per unit effort<br />

of salmon can amount to a maximum cif . about± 0.5 salmon per 1000 hooks.<br />

This possible error, however, has to be neglected, because the necessary<br />

figures for a correction are not available,for all years.
